Our top home improvement ideas for small spaces

1. Multifunctional Furniture Magic

The cornerstone of optimizing small spaces is investing in multifunctional furniture. Carefully selected multi-function furniture is one of the most effect home improvement ideas for small living spaces. Consider pieces that serve dual purposes, such as a sofa bed, ottomans with hidden storage, or a foldable dining table.

These transformative furniture items not only save space but also enhance the versatility of your living areas, adapting seamlessly to your evolving needs.

2. Wall-Mounted Wonders

When floor space is at a premium, look upward for untapped potential. Wall-mounted shelves, floating desks, and modular storage systems can be game-changers. Not only do they free up valuable floor space, but they also serve as decorative elements, allowing you to showcase your personality through carefully curated displays of books, art, and personal mementos.

3. The Illusion of Space with Mirrors

Using mirrors in your décor with neutral colours will reflect light even in small spaces

Strategically placing mirrors in small rooms can work wonders by expanding visual boundaries and infusing an airy ambiance. Mirrors are a among the greatest most effect home improvement ideas. Whether adorning an entire wall or strategically placed to capture and bounce natural or artificial light, mirrors enhance brightness while simultaneously making rooms appear more spacious.

The reflective surfaces not only contribute to an optical expansion of the space but also add a touch of sophistication to the overall aesthetic. Consider oversized mirrors to make a bold statement or strategically position smaller mirrors to create focal points, transforming the limitations of a confined space into an expansive and visually captivating environment.

The versatility of mirrors makes them an indispensable tool for small space dwellers aiming to maximize both style and perception within their homes.

4. Let There Be Light

Adequate lighting not only illuminates a room but also plays a pivotal role in creating the illusion of spaciousness. 5. Vertical Gardens for Green Living

Bringing nature indoors is a timeless home improvement strategy. In small spaces, vertical gardens can be a breath of fresh air, literally. These space-saving gardens not only introduce greenery but also add a visually appealing element to your home. Experiment with hanging planters, wall-mounted pots, or even a dedicated vertical garden structure to infuse life into your compact living quarters.

6. Customized Storage Solutions

A wise design decision as well as a practical one is to embrace built-in cabinets, under-stair storage, and modular closet systems in the world of small spaces, where fighting clutter is a never-ending struggle. These solutions ensure that each storage unit is precisely crafted to fit the unique dimensions of your space, turning seemingly awkward corners and unused spaces into valuable storage real estate.

7. Transformative Room Dividers

Create defined spaces within your small home with stylish room dividers. Folding screens, bookshelves, or sliding panels can provide both privacy and aesthetic appeal. Choose designs that complement your overall décor while adding a touch of flair to the functional aspect of dividing spaces.

9. Play with Textures and Patterns

Using textures and patterns adds interest to your décor

While a minimalist approach often dominates small spaces, introducing carefully chosen textures and subtle patterns can transform a bland environment into a visually captivating haven. Consider incorporating textured accent walls that not only draw the eye but also create a tactile experience.

Opt for patterned rugs to anchor your living space, providing both warmth and visual interest without overwhelming the room. Selecting textured upholstery for furniture pieces introduces an element of luxury and comfort. The key lies in finding a delicate balance; too much can feel cluttered, but the right mix of textures and patterns can turn a small space into a harmonious, visually intriguing retreat.

Whether it’s through woven textiles, textured wallpapers, or patterned throw pillows, playing with textures and patterns allows you to infuse personality and style into your compact living areas.
